Tickseed Coreopsis

What do you do with the Tickseed Coreopsis flower before winter sets in? I have just planted the Tickseed Coreopsis flowers and I want to know what to do with the plants before winter. Should I cut them back to ground level or just let them alone?

According to my research cutting down tick seed coreopsis may decrease their chance of winter survival and risk the plant putting on new growth using energy reserves intended for spring. So, I would recommend leaving them alone.
